Jorge Messi, Father and Former Agent of Lionel Messi, Dies at 68

Jorge Messi worked in a steel factory in Rosario before moving to Europe when his son joined Barcelona's academy in 2000.

Safi – Jorge Messi, the father and longtime agent of Argentine soccer star Lionel Messi, died on Friday night at the age of 68 in Rosario, Argentina, after a long illness, the family confirmed.

He spent his final months between a medical center in his native Rosario and his home, accompanied by his wife, Celia, and children Rodrigo, Matías and María Sol. 

Jorge is survived by Celia and their four children, including Lionel and his older brothers Rodrigo and Matías and younger sister María Sol.

The family had kept Jorge’s illness private before disclosing a “health situation” during the 2026 World Cup. After scoring in Argentina’s opening win over Algeria in June, Lionel Messi said his tears were due to “something unrelated to football.”

“I have been through some difficult, complicated days,” he told reporters. “I am thankful for the support I have received from my teammates and the staff during this time.”

Jorge Messi worked in a steel factory in Rosario before moving to Europe when his son joined Barcelona’s academy in 2000. He went on to manage Lionel’s career, from Barcelona to Paris Saint-Germain (PSG) and then Major League Soccer (MLS) side Inter Miami.

Newell’s Old Boys, the club where Lionel Messi began, was among the first to pay tribute. “Newell’s Old Boys bid farewell with deep pain and sorrow to Jorge Messi,” the club wrote, describing him as the person who, with his wife Celia, “supported with vision, rigour and affection the career of the greatest player of all time.”

“I always needed my dad’s approval, ever since I was a kid,” Lionel Messi has recalled. “After every match, I’d ask him what he thought of how I played.”

Beyond confirming the death, the family had not released a public statement as of Saturday.

Under his father’s guidance, Lionel Messi won a record eight Ballon d’Or awards, given to the world’s best player, and led Argentina to the 2022 World Cup title. 

Jorge was unable to attend this year’s tournament in North America, where Argentina lost the final 1-0 to Spain. His son spent time with him in Rosario before returning to Inter Miami a week ago.
